The Branco Tank can be found on the Cebolla USGS quad topo map. Branco Tank is a reservoir in Rio Arriba County in the state of New Mexico. The latitude and longitude coordinates for this reservoir are 36.5500, -106.4475 and the altitude is 8064 feet (2458 meters).
